Subject: Reset flow cut-over — wrap-up

Hi future maintainers,

The password reset revamp for Lanternly shipped last night. Old token emails stopped at midnight; new flow uses short-lived links and the Driftwell mailer. Cut-over was smooth — one brief queue backlog, cleared in ten minutes. Legacy templates are archived, don't resurrect them. If reset emails stall, check the mailer queue first, then token expiry settings. For reference, the service went live with the configuration below.

deployment values, fawef-tawef:
[gilox]
host = gilox.olvarqsoft.corp
user = gilox_svc
database = gilox_prod

Flagwell is Corvane Systems' feature-flag rollout framework. All flag definitions are bundled and signed before distribution to edge nodes, and the agent refuses unsigned bundles. Rollout percentages are evaluated client-side, so bundle integrity is the primary trust boundary. Audit logs of flag changes are retained for ninety days. For verification during review, the bundle signing key is as follows.

rollout seal: bky3_Zik

- [ ] **Step 7: Breaker override escrow.** After sealing the signing keys for the Tallgrove upstream API circuit breaker, confirm the support team can force the breaker open during a full outage. The override bundle lives in the sealed escrow drawer and is useless without its unlock phrase. Two ceremony witnesses must initial this step before proceeding. The escrow bundle is decrypted with the recovery passphrase that follows.

vault phrase of kahip-kahop = holath-quenmir

Handover — ProctorLine queue, for the release manager

Handing off the ProctorLine exam-proctoring queue ahead of the Thursday cut. Backlog is healthy; the retry worker was patched last sprint and no longer duplicates flag events. Two items remain open: the dead-letter drain job still needs a schedule, and the Averton region consumer lags during peak sessions. If the queue admin account locks during release, recovery goes through the sealed console rather than the normal login. The console accepts the recovery passphrase noted directly below.

unlock words, yagaf-yagep: ulaox-silath-julael-aldix-kasath-jorath-ulays-druael-eliir-sorvan-silion-kasok-fraok